Transaction 74a76f710281441b1c5726de4028e3e6cc85a833a8e345116ec33c4db5e61750
1 Input
1 Output
-
74a76f710281441b1c5726de4028e3e6cc85a833a8e345116ec33c4db5e61750:0
- value
- 637508
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c2f314fae5c0a074ad7aee9808e92b219be210bd9388ecad4c57e4462ea7b451
- address
- bc1pcte3f7h9czs8ftt6a6vq36ftyxd7yy9ajwywet2v2ljyvt48k3gsktaah2